Institute for Advanced Learning and Research

Inside IALR

Inside IALR explores the ways that the Institute for Advanced Learning and Research (IALR) catalyzes economic transformation. Listen for a behind-the-scenes view of how our programs, people and partnerships are impacting Southern Virginia and beyond. Host Caleb Ayers and Producer Daniel Dalton interview someone new every episode, introducing listeners to IALR leaders and partners, promoting programs and highlighting opportunities to connect with us.   New episodes are published every other Monday.

Industry 4.0: Robots, Automation and Efficiency 29.01.2024

What is Industry 4.0? It involves interconnected machines and data analysis capabilities, and it's what allows three robots to utilize two CNC machines and several other tools and processes to convert a piece of raw material into a finished packaged product without any human involvement inside IALR's Industry 4.0 Integration Lab.  The "Inside IALR" team is on location inside th...

Circular Fashion and Textile Recycling 02.01.2024

The average piece of clothing in the U.S. is now worn just seven times, and worldwide, less than 1% of textile waste gets recycled back into textiles.
